    Centralized GPF Module expands online GPF account mapping and access, enabling electronic advances and streamlined pension processing.
    The Centralized GPF Module in PFMS will map GPF accounts to unique employee IDs, provide online GPF balances and enable electronic applications for advances and withdrawals to streamline accounting and balance transfers. The ePPO module integrates BHAVISHYA and PARAS with PFMS for end to end electronic pension case processing, reducing delays and errors of manual workflows.

    Central government receipts and tax devolution disclosed, with expenditure composition and key revenue outlays detailed.
    Monthly consolidated account up to January 2018 reports Union Government receipts composed of Tax Revenue (Net to Centre), Non-Tax Revenue, and Non-Debt Capital Receipts (loan recoveries and PSU disinvestment); records transfers to States as devolution of share of taxes and an increase over the prior year period; and details total expenditure split into Revenue and Capital accounts with major Revenue Expenditure items identified as Interest Payments and Major Subsidies.

    Agriculture credit target mobilizes banking investment and fintech to boost farmer incomes and rural capital formation.
    An 11 lakh crore agriculture credit flow target for 2018-19 is presented as achievable and intended to support doubling farmers' income; banks are directed to prioritise priority sector lending to agriculture, invest in long term agricultural assets to improve capital formation, and adopt financial technology to enhance rural finance efficiency. Administrative measures stress financial inclusion, targeted outreach to underserved regions, operationalisation of budgeted sectoral funds including support for a rural housing scheme and a Micro Irrigation Fund, and accelerated formation of Farmer Producer Organisations to improve access to credit and services.

    Special investigation team sought for alleged bank fraud, with deportation and loan-reform measures requested.
    Petitions request an independent probe via a special investigation team, deportation proceedings against alleged perpetrators, inquiry into top bank management, and systemic reforms including loan disbursal guidelines, an experts' body for bad debts, rules for prompt loan recovery by attachment and auction, and measures to fasten liability on bank employees who sanctioned loans on deficient documentation.

    Operational risk from employee misconduct prompts supervisory assessment and potential regulatory action by regulator.
    Operational risk due to employee delinquency and internal control failure is the core issue; the regulator denied directing the bank to meet other banks' obligations under Letter of Undertaking (LOU) arrangements and has undertaken a supervisory assessment of the bank's control systems with a statement that appropriate supervisory action will follow.

    Private placement consent: shareholder special resolution required with enhanced disclosures and procedural safeguards for securities offers.
    A company must obtain a special resolution for each private placement offer and provide detailed disclosures in the explanatory statement and private placement offer cum application (Form PAS 4), including valuation and price justification, amount to be raised, use of proceeds, promoters' contribution, risk factors, defaults, litigation, regulatory inquiries, and nodal officer details. Offers are capped by the per security allottees limit with exclusions for qualified institutional buyers and employees; recordkeeping in Form PAS 5, allotment filing in Form PAS 3, and payment from subscriber bank accounts are mandated.

    Policy rate decision: MPC maintains policy rate as government notes growth acceleration and inflation convergence.
    MPC updated inflation and real GDP growth projections, projecting growth acceleration in 2018-19 and inflation converging to target in the second half of the next fiscal year; the Government welcomed this assessment and noted the MPC's decision to maintain the Policy Rate.
